Please note that refunds and time changes are not acceptable after the purchase
The time listed on the ticket is the time you can line up in the waiting line. You cannot line up earlier than the stated time
Depending on the number of visitors, you may have to wait before entering
Please line up after everyone in the same booking has gathered
Please note that re-entry is not permitted
[Weekdays] 11:00 am - 8:00 pm (Last admission at 7:00 pm on the day of admission)
[Saturdays, Sundays, and Holidays/Fixed-date] 10:00 am - 9:00 pm (Last admission at 8:00 pm on the day of admission)
A visit to Unko Museum Tokyo typically takes about 60 to 90 minutes. This duration allows ample time to explore all the interactive exhibits, engage in the various poop-themed games, and capture fun photos throughout the museum. The exact time may vary based on how much you interact with each attraction and the crowd levels during your visit.
To experience Unko Museum Tokyo with fewer crowds, it is generally recommended to visit on a weekday, especially during the morning shortly after opening. Weekends and public holidays tend to be busier, so planning your visit during off-peak hours can provide a more relaxed and enjoyable experience with easier access to all attractions.

Yes, Unko Museum Tokyo is packed with interactive games and activities designed for all ages. You can create your own unique poop at "MY POOP MAKER," witness the exciting eruption of "POOP VOLCANO," enjoy the playful "Poop Throwing" challenge, move to the beat in the "Dancing Poop Room," and test your skills at the "CRAPPY GAME CORNER." There's always something engaging to do.
